It’s likely that a great number of people in the African nation of Uganda still cringe when they hear the name Idi Amin. The mentally unstable tyrant is believed to have had some 300,000 people tortured or killed during his reign. Some claim that Amin kept the heads and other various body parts from some of his victims in a refrigerator and once told his minister of health that he found the taste of human flesh “rather too salty.” During the 1970’s Amin bestowed upon himself the title of, “His Excellency President for Life, Field Marshal Al Hadji Doctor Idi Amin, VC, DSO, MC, Lord of All the Beasts of the Earth and Fishes of the Sea, and Conqueror of the British Empire in Africa in General and Uganda in Particular.”
